Senior Project Manager – Nuclear Upgrade Programme

The Senior Project Manager will lead an upgrade programme of works within a nuclear licenced site, reporting to the Project Lead or Project Director. This critical role involves owning, planning, managing, and delivering diverse projects to support a wider infrastructure upgrade within a matrix team framework with multiple stakeholders and competing priorities.

Due to the strict security requirements, candidates must be a UK National and will need to progress through security clearance.


Key Responsibilities

  • Scope Management

    • Draft scope of works documents
    • Incorporate comments through the document control system to enable procurement packages
  • Project Delivery & Risk Management

    • Manage and deliver allocated project packages under the direction of the Project Lead/Project Director
    • Reduce risks through gate reviews to ensure successful project progression
    • Provide regular updates on scheduling, risk, cost, and quality via weekly project reports and team reviews

  • Compliance & Discipline

    • Ensure adherence to all working practices, safety protocols, quality standards, and corporate procedures
    • Monitor compliance and maintain discipline across the project
  • Stakeholder & Subcontractor Engagement

    • Collabrate with subcontractors to clarify scope, work, and scheduling requirements
    • Act as line manager for an Assistant Project Manager

Requirements

  • Technical & Planning Expertise

    • Proven ability in technical problem-solving, interpreting product design/engineering discussions (including mechanical, electrical, or control systems)
    • Strong understanding of product lifecycle planning & management
    • Ability to identify project/system-level interfaces and influence critical path timings
  • Communication & Stakeholder Management

    • Exceptional communication, presentation, and stakeholder engagement skills
    • Experience integrating and influencing across cross-functional teams in a structured organisation
  • Qualifications & Experience

    • Degree level qualification or equivalent
    • Membership of an appropriate professional body (desirable)
    • Essential experience in fast-paced project environments
    • Preference for SQEP-assessed candidates in nuclear engineering, design, or project management
    • Desirable experience in nuclear or highly regulated sectors
